Understanding Minimalism is a journey towards simplifying your life and focusing on what truly matters. At its core, minimalism means living with less—less clutter, less stress, and less distraction. By stripping away the excess, individuals can make room for meaningful experiences and relationships. Embracing minimalism can lead to reduced anxiety, increased clarity, and a deeper appreciation for the things that truly enrich our lives. For many, this path begins with decluttering physical spaces, which not only creates a more serene environment but also promotes mental well-being.
To practice minimalism effectively, consider these key principles:
1. Evaluate Your Possessions: Regularly assess what you own and determine its value to your life.
2. Set Intentions: Identify your priorities and align your lifestyle accordingly.
3. Practice Mindfulness: Be present and conscious of your consumption habits. By adopting these principles, you will not only become more organized but will also cultivate a lifestyle that emphasizes quality over quantity. Ultimately, minimalism is less about deprivation and more about creating space for joy, freedom, and authenticity.

Minimalism has gained considerable attention in recent years, but is it right for you? Before embarking on a minimalist lifestyle, it’s essential to assess your current situation and values. Start by asking yourself a few key questions: What do I truly value in my life?, How much time do I spend on possessions compared to experiences?, and Am I overwhelmed by clutter? Reflecting on these questions can help clarify whether the principles of minimalism align with your lifestyle goals.
To further guide your self-reflection, consider creating a list of items and priorities in your life.
